When Is Water Heater Repair the Right Choice?
In many cases, a water heater can be repaired, especially when the problem is minor. Common repairable issues include:
- Faulty thermostats
- Sediment buildup inside the tank
- Malfunctioning heating elements
If your water heater still produces hot water but isn’t working as efficiently as it should, a repair may be all that’s needed. However, if you’re dealing with frequent breakdowns, inconsistent hot water, or visible leaks, replacement may be the smarter long-term option.
